Best Paragliding Podcasts and YouTube Channels for Staying Updated on Technical Innovations

Paragliding is a dynamic sport where technology evolves rapidly---from lightweight wings and advanced harnesses to digital flight instruments and safety equipment. For pilots who want to stay on top of the latest innovations, podcasts and YouTube channels provide a convenient and engaging way to learn about emerging gear, techniques, and trends.

1. Why Follow Paragliding Media Channels

Technical innovation in paragliding can directly impact flight safety, performance, and overall experience. Staying informed allows pilots to:

  • Understand the benefits and limitations of new wings, harnesses, and instruments.
  • Learn how to integrate new technology into existing flying routines.
  • Keep up with safety advancements, including rescue systems and smart flight tracking devices.
  • Gain insight from expert pilots and manufacturers who share real-world testing and reviews.

Podcasts and video channels make it easy to digest this information on the go or through visual demonstrations, which are particularly helpful for understanding complex gear or aerodynamic concepts.

4. How to Use These Channels for Maximum Benefit

  • Subscribe and set alerts: Ensure you don't miss new episodes that cover cutting-edge technology or pilot interviews.
  • Follow along with your own gear: Compare updates to your current wing, harness, or instruments to see if upgrades make sense.
  • Take notes on technical features: Documenting specs, handling differences, and instrument functionalities helps when evaluating new purchases.
  • Engage with the community: Many channels allow comments or have associated forums where pilots discuss lessons learned from new technology.

By actively engaging with content, pilots turn passive learning into practical knowledge that can be applied in the air.

5. Tips for Evaluating Technical Innovations

Even when following expert channels, it's important to critically assess innovations:

  • Check manufacturer credibility: Ensure the product is developed by a reputable company with safety certification.
  • Look for field-tested reviews: Video demonstrations and pilot experiences provide context beyond marketing claims.
  • Assess compatibility with your skill level: Advanced technology may require additional training to use safely.
  • Track trends over time: Some innovations take multiple iterations before becoming reliable, so follow recurring updates on new gear.

A measured approach ensures you benefit from technology without taking unnecessary risks.
